The Rembrandt Hotel – London

A Historic Venue with a Modern Edge for Meetings and Events, in an Enviable Location in the Heart of London

Knightsbridge epitomises London’s elegance, and The Rembrandt Hotel sits at its very heart. Built in 1911, this Edwardian gem blends historic charm with modern practicality, serving as a versatile venue for meetings, conferences, and events. Surrounded by iconic landmarks—including the Victoria and Albert Museum, Harrods, Hyde Park, and the Royal Albert Hall—it offers a unique setting for cultural enrichment and leisure.

Just a seven-minute walk from South Kensington Underground Station, the hotel provides seamless access to London’s transport network. International delegates will appreciate that Heathrow Airport is only a 40/45-minute tube journey away.

Flexible Spaces to Suit Any Occasion

Behind the hotel’s grand Edwardian façade lies a host of flexible spaces ideal for events of all sizes. The Rembrandt’s six function rooms can accommodate anything from a board meeting for 10 to a theatre-style conference for 200 in the impressive Kings Suite. Smaller rooms, such as The Conservatory, offer bright, intimate settings for networking or brainstorming sessions.

The appeal of The Rembrandt lies in its ability to blend functionality with character. Excellent audio-visual equipment and complimentary high-speed Wi-Fi ensure that the practicalities of any event are covered, while the hotel’s historic architecture provides a backdrop that elevates the experience, making even the most routine meeting feel special.

Comfortable Accommodation for Delegates

For multi-day events, The Rembrandt offers much more than just a place to convene. Its 194 guest rooms are a harmonious blend of timeless design and contemporary comforts.

Luxurious bedding, flat-screen TVs, and thoughtfully designed workspaces ensure that delegates can unwind or prepare in comfort, while the tranquil interiors provide a welcome escape from the demands of the day.

Catering That Leaves a Lasting Impression

Catering is another area where The Rembrandt excels. Whether it’s a formal banquet or a relaxed working lunch, the hotel’s culinary team creates menus tailored to every occasion. The Palette Restaurant serves a refined selection of British and international dishes, while the 1606 Lounge Bar is ideal for informal drinks after a long day. For something quintessentially British, the hotel’s Afternoon Tea—complete with delicate pastries and fresh scones—adds an indulgent touch to any event.
